The Kentucky State Capitol, a breathtaking symbol of the Bluegrass State’s legislative power, beckons visitors with its striking architecture and rich historical significance. Constructed in the early 20th century, this impressive building is adorned with classical columns and a grand dome that stands as a centerpiece of Frankfort. The Capitol is not just an office for government officials; it is a public space that encourages civic engagement and historical appreciation. The surrounding grounds are meticulously landscaped, offering a serene environment for a leisurely stroll while marveling at the beauty of the building. Inside, the Capitol is filled with stunning artwork, including murals and sculptures that depict key moments in Kentucky’s history. Visitors can embark on a guided tour to learn about the legislative process and the roles played by various government officials throughout the state's past. The Capitol also houses a museum that showcases Kentucky's rich heritage, making it an educational experience for tourists of all ages. Local tips

  • Visit during weekdays for a chance to see the legislature in session.
  • Check the official website for guided tour schedules and special events.
  • Bring a camera; the Capitol is especially beautiful at sunset.
  • Explore the surrounding grounds for additional monuments and historical markers.
